Why Replace Your Door Locks?
Before diving into the types of locks, let's consider why you might desire to change your door locks at all:
- Enhanced Security: Old locks may have vulnerabilities that can be easily exploited. Upgrading to a more recent design improves overall security.
- Lost Keys: If you've lost your keys or had them stolen, changing the lock guarantees that unauthorized people can not get.
- Wear and Tear: Locks can use out gradually. If a lock is challenging to turn or sticks, it may be time for a replacement.
- Home Renovations: When updating the aesthetic appeals of your home, new locks can contribute to the general design.
Types of Door Locks
There are numerous kinds of door locks readily available, each with its unique advantages. The following table sums up a few of the most typical door locks:
Type of Lock
Description
Pros
Cons
Best For
Deadbolt Lock
A heavy-duty lock that requires an essential to open.
High security, resistant to choosing
Installation can be complicated
External doors
Smart Lock
An electronic lock that can be managed via smart device or keypad.
Remote access, keyless entry
Requires batteries, can be hacked
Modern homes
Knob Lock
A simple mechanism that's typically seen on interior doors.
Economical, easy to set up
Low security, quickly bypassed
Interior doors
Lever Handle Lock
A lock with a lever handle, generally discovered in commercial buildings.
Easy to run, ADA certified
Less secure than deadbolts
Workplace buildings, commercial areas
Mortise Lock
A lock that's set up within the door, requiring a pocket to be cut into the door.
High security, durable
More expensive and complicated installation
High-end residential, commercial
Rim Lock
Installed on the surface of the door and generally used in older homes.
Historic style, simple to set up
Lower security than mortise locks
Old-fashioned homes

Tips for Choosing the Right Lock
Choosing the best lock can be a difficult job. Here are some tips to assist simplify the process:
Assess Your Needs: Consider the function of the lock (front door, back door, garage, etc) and the level of security needed.
Pick the Appropriate Type: Depending on your choices for benefit, looks, and security, pick a lock type that meets your requirements.
Inspect Security Ratings: Look for locks that have been graded by ANSI/BHMA. Grade 1 is the highest security ranking.
Think about Installation: Some locks are simple to install, while others might require expert assistance. Evaluate your DIY abilities before purchasing.
Assess Smart Features: If interested in smart technology, make sure compatibility with your existing devices and systems.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. How typically should I replace my door locks?
As a general general rule, it is advised to change door locks every 5-7 years, depending on wear and tear, or faster if you feel the security has been jeopardized.
2. Can I set up a deadbolt on my existing door?
The majority of doors can accommodate a deadbolt, however you might require to drill additional holes. Ensure you follow the producer's directions for correct installation.
3. Are smart locks more secure than traditional locks?
Smart locks feature additional security measures, such as two-factor authentication. Nevertheless, they can be susceptible to hacking if not correctly protected. Traditional locks are normally more resilient to physical attacks.

5. Can I re-key a lock myself?
Lots of modern locks, especially those with SmartKey innovation, can be re-keyed easily at home with very little tools. However, always speak with the user handbook for particular instructions.
